The Private 2 @ Khao Kho Hotel
16.63554, 100.99071Noen Mahatsachan is within a 7-km distance of the 3-star Private 2 @ Khao Kho Hotel, which boasts a terrace and a garden.
Location
The hotel is about 40 km from Phetchabun airport and nearly a 10-minute ride from such cultural venues as Itthi Artillery Support Base Museum. Approximately a 10-minute ride from this property you will reach Khao Kho Zoo. There is Khao Kho Memorial approximately a 10-minute ride from the hotel.
Rooms
The Private 2 @ has 6 rooms, comprising a balcony and a place for dining. A flat-screen TV with satellite channels, along with coffee/tea making machines, are offered. The Private 2 @ Khao Kho Hotel also provides guests with tea and coffee making facilities, and a fridge.

We were initially concerned about the steep road leading to the hotel, but the owner kindly offered us a pickup truck to transport us. The beautiful surroundings and stunning valley view from our large balcony made up for any inconvenience. The rooms were clean, spacious, and had a great hot shower. Although the WiFi was not consistent, this is to be expected in mountain hotel areas. The housekeeper, despite not speaking English, was cheerful and got things done. The staff were warm, helpful, and responsive. Breakfast had a good spread, although the porridge seasoning was a bit strong for my taste. The overall experience was great, and I would recommend this hotel.
